1. The Science of Dreary Days: Why We Feel the Way We Do

The scientific explanation behind our "dreary day" blues is multifaceted. Reduced sunlight directly impacts our serotonin levels, the neurotransmitter associated with mood regulation. This dip can lead to feelings of lethargy, sadness, and even irritability. Furthermore, the lack of bright light disrupts our circadian rhythm, the internal clock governing our sleep-wake cycle, contributing to fatigue and decreased alertness. Consider, for instance, the prevalence of Seasonal Affective Disorder (SAD), a type of depression linked to shorter days and reduced sunlight exposure during winter months. This demonstrates the tangible physiological impact of a consistently dreary environment.

2. The Cultural Connotations of Grey: From Melancholy to Introspection

Throughout history and across cultures, grey has been imbued with a rich tapestry of meanings. While it can represent sadness and gloom, it also symbolizes contemplation, wisdom, and even sophistication. Think of the melancholic beauty of a rainy Parisian street depicted in countless paintings and films, or the contemplative stillness portrayed in Japanese woodblock prints featuring misty landscapes. These artistic representations illustrate the nuanced emotional landscape associated with dreary days. The grey isn't simply negative; it provides a backdrop for deeper emotional exploration and creative reflection. The somber atmosphere can encourage introspection, a chance to process thoughts and emotions that often get lost in the hustle of brighter days.


3. Embracing the Productivity Paradox: Finding Focus in the Gloom

Ironically, the stillness of a dreary day can be surprisingly productive. The lack of vibrant stimulation can paradoxically improve focus and concentration for some. The muted light and quieter atmosphere eliminate some of the external distractions that hinder productivity. Consider the classic image of the writer hunched over their manuscript in a dimly lit room – a testament to the potential for creativity in a less stimulating environment. Many find that tasks requiring deep thought and concentration are better suited to quieter, less visually stimulating days. This is supported by research demonstrating that ambient noise can hinder cognitive performance, making the relative quiet of a dreary day a potential advantage.

Expert FAQs:

1. How can I combat the negative effects of reduced sunlight on my mood? Light therapy, regular exercise, and maintaining a consistent sleep schedule are effective strategies. Spending time outdoors even on cloudy days can also help.

2. Is it possible to be productive on a dreary day? Absolutely! Choose tasks requiring deep focus, create a comfortable workspace, and minimize distractions.

3. How can I prevent dreary days from leading to SAD? Maintaining a healthy lifestyle, seeking social interaction, and ensuring adequate exposure to artificial light sources (especially during shorter days) are crucial. Professional help is also advisable if symptoms persist.

4. What are some activities ideal for a quiet day? Reading, writing, painting, knitting, playing board games, listening to music, cooking, and spending quality time with loved ones are all excellent choices.

5. Can dreary days be beneficial for creativity? Yes, the reduced stimulation can enhance focus and promote introspection, leading to innovative thinking and creative breakthroughs for some individuals.
